Output fc89f95cac32d390811ff3c60222fa4113cd2b1aae88ba10fd7a943566bd2a17:0

value
1000420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b27e5aa3d439845216c12e7ee1f61743e595499 OP_EQUAL
address
375oaxoKg5BrwMtff17Ps5qXZEZRd9kDhR
transaction
fc89f95cac32d390811ff3c60222fa4113cd2b1aae88ba10fd7a943566bd2a17
confirmations
304325
spent
true